Latest Patents

Ljudmila holds a patent for a method of testing wear resistance of articles. This method involves measuring the rate of propagation of ultrasonic oscillations in a reference article that has the lowest admissible wear resistance. The rate of propagation in the articles being tested is compared with that of the reference article. The reference article is suspended in a liquid, and the articles being tested are placed in the same liquid. Any articles that ascend to the surface are rejected, ensuring only the most reliable materials are evaluated. She has 1 patent to her name.
